echo "=== Setting WCE with qdev and with manually created BB ==="
 | 
			
		||||
echo
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
# The qdev option takes precedence, but if it isn't given or 'auto', the BB
 | 
			
		||||
# option is used instead.
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
for cache in "writeback" "writethrough"; do
 | 
			
		||||
    for wce in "" ",write-cache=auto" ",write-cache=on" ",write-cache=off"; do
 | 
			
		||||
        echo "info block" \
 | 
			
		||||
            | run_qemu -drive "$drive,cache=$cache" \
 | 
			
		||||
                       -device "virtio-blk,drive=none0$wce" \
 | 
			
		||||
            | grep -e "Testing" -e "Cache mode"
 | 
			
		||||
    done
 | 
			
		||||
done

=== Setting WCE with qdev and with manually created BB ===
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
Testing: -drive if=none,file=TEST_DIR/t.qcow2,driver=qcow2,cache=writeback -device virtio-blk,drive=none0
 | 
			
		||||
    Cache mode:       writeback
 | 
			
		||||
Testing: -drive if=none,file=TEST_DIR/t.qcow2,driver=qcow2,cache=writeback -device virtio-blk,drive=none0,write-cache=auto
 | 
			
		||||
    Cache mode:       writeback
 | 
			
		||||
Testing: -drive if=none,file=TEST_DIR/t.qcow2,driver=qcow2,cache=writeback -device virtio-blk,drive=none0,write-cache=on
 | 
			
		||||
    Cache mode:       writeback
 | 
			
		||||
Testing: -drive if=none,file=TEST_DIR/t.qcow2,driver=qcow2,cache=writeback -device virtio-blk,drive=none0,write-cache=off
 | 
			
		||||
    Cache mode:       writethrough
 | 
			
		||||
Testing: -drive if=none,file=TEST_DIR/t.qcow2,driver=qcow2,cache=writethrough -device virtio-blk,drive=none0
 | 
			
		||||
    Cache mode:       writethrough
 | 
			
		||||
Testing: -drive if=none,file=TEST_DIR/t.qcow2,driver=qcow2,cache=writethrough -device virtio-blk,drive=none0,write-cache=auto
 | 
			
		||||
    Cache mode:       writethrough
 | 
			
		||||
Testing: -drive if=none,file=TEST_DIR/t.qcow2,driver=qcow2,cache=writethrough -device virtio-blk,drive=none0,write-cache=on
 | 
			
		||||
    Cache mode:       writeback
 | 
			
		||||
Testing: -drive if=none,file=TEST_DIR/t.qcow2,driver=qcow2,cache=writethrough -device virtio-blk,drive=none0,write-cache=off
 | 
			
		||||
    Cache mode:       writethrough
